Located in West Yarmouth on Cape Cod, Ann & Fran’s Kitchen Serving generations of Cape Codders since 1975. Ann and Fran’s has been a neighborhood staple.

Amongst the hustle on bustle of busy Rt 28 in Yarmouth you will find Anne and Fran’s , an amazing eatery that offers breakfast and lunch with a creative twist on all the classics. Tyler and his staff have created a menu with an eye fixed on the modern palette with well thought out combinations of flavors, some familiar and some which may be new to you, but ALL delicious. Vegans and vegetarians will welcome the plant based options and dishes . As a carnivore though, I will say their smoked slab bacon is out of this world delicious !

If your crew is hungry and a solid breakfast or lunch is your aim trust me, you will be happy you found yourself here in their cozy coastal themed dining room. So don’t let the sometimes long lines in the summer intimidate you, Anne and Fran’s is popular for a reason. Get in there and check it out.

Small craft kitchen for breakfast. Each dish has a special flair. While there are less “crafty” options, try the duck hash or the buckwheat waffles. The kid’s menu has more traditional breakfast offerings…but get them to try the good stuff. In summer, the line and wait are long…and we know why! Open in winter, same great menu with fewer people. This is my new “go to” breakfast restaurant. Forgot to take pictures except the lone remaining my donut hole.. gingerbread for the season. Yum

Fantastic experience today at Ann and Fran’s. The food is exceptional and the service/friendliness of the staff is unmatched. I had the lobster Benedict and it far exceeded my expectations. It was served on a pillowy brioche that melted in your mouth, and the corn chow chow was a really nice compliment to the rich lobster (today’s market price was $36). We also tried the strawberry toast as an appetizer. Mascarpone and goat cheese with a strawberry preserve on top with honey- it was sweet and savory in all the right ways! We also got the slow roasted hash, which was absolutely delicious and very flavorful. Space is very limited inside, and although they can accommodate larger parties, you can always expect a wait. On that note- we witnessed a few parties, get called but not report back to the host to stand in a timely manner. The restaurant was extremely accommodating and patient and did their best to ensure people on the list were notified, but there were a lot of angry tourists who didn’t have any patience for a small business. Kudos to the hostess for handling it so well. Would 1000% recommend Ann and Fran’s!
